Output 65d27dcce22fb1945668f610f42a5d5a59e55ec676a52491f320ccf77c5ea721:3

value
103333
script pubkey
OP_0 OP_PUSHBYTES_20 f53d453f04c8331007c5842af84e7f13532a96d5
address
tb1q757520cyeqe3qp79ss40snnlzdfj49k4t2ezdw
transaction
65d27dcce22fb1945668f610f42a5d5a59e55ec676a52491f320ccf77c5ea721